What is Six Sigma?
Six Sigma is a data-driven approach that aims at refining operational workflows by reducing variations and reducing variation. By utilizing statistical tools and a structured methodology known as DMAIC (Define, Measure, Analyze, Improve, Control), Six Sigma helps companies deliver significant improvements in quality, client satisfaction, and process performance.
Originally formed by Motorola and promoted by giants like General Electric, Six Sigma has grown into a globally recognized standard for process improvement. Today, it is used by organizations of all sizes to streamline operations, lower costs, and deliver consistent results.

Six Sigma Certification Levels
There are various tiers of Six Sigma certification, each representing a different degree of responsibility. The most popular include Six Sigma Green Belt and Six Sigma Black Belt.
Six Sigma Green Belt certification is suitable for professionals who want to handle smaller optimization projects or support larger programs. Green Belts are trained to evaluate and solve quality challenges and are well-versed in the Six Sigma methodology.
Six Sigma Black Belt training is more advanced, designed for individuals who lead interdepartmental project teams. Black Belts possess a strong understanding of statistical analysis and are able to manage large-scale improvement projects that can generate significant cost reductions and productivity gains.
